## Ownership: session-token refresh bug

Heads up, newcomers: Larkspool has a long-running quirk where session tokens occasionally refresh twice in quick succession, logging users out on slow connections. There's a partial mitigation in `auth/refresh.go`, but the real fix is still in flight. Don't touch the token clock-skew constants without asking first. Questions, repro cases, or suspected regressions should go to the engineer named below.

account owner for bawip-tahag: Raleth Quenok

Subject: Renewal of Corporate Insurance Programme — Detailed Summary

Dear colleagues,

Our combined policy with Arbenfield Assurance is due for renewal on 30 April. The proposed premium reflects a 7.4% increase, driven chiefly by revised flood-risk ratings at the Colmere warehouse. Cover limits remain unchanged; the deductible on marine cargo rises slightly. Finance should accrue the difference from Q2 onward and confirm the payment schedule with treasury.

A full broker comparison is attached for review.

The note below explains the timing.

board note of yagap-fahop: The northern region missed its Julix quota by 6.7 percent last quarter. Goroxix Partners plans to raise the Caswyn list price by 6.7 percent in April. The board signed off on a budget of $201.2 million for Project Gilath. The renewal with Zoriusax Group closes at $431.5 million a year, 51.5 percent below the last contract.

Hi, welcome to on-call for Ledgerpine. The tax-rate lookup cache refreshes from the rates service every six hours; stale entries beyond twelve hours trigger a paging alert because invoices would compute with outdated rates. Most incidents are refresh-job timeouts — restart the job and verify the freshness metric recovers within ten minutes. Never flush the whole cache during business hours; partial invalidation is safer. The refresh commands and escalation path are documented on the internal page here.

runbook for tafof-yawif: https://confluence.tolvaqsys.internal/display/display/browse/pages/7be3

Subject: Scheduled key rotation — Graphwright visualizer

Hello on-call,

As part of our quarterly credential hygiene, the API key used by the Graphwright dependency graph visualizer to query the Mossline build-metadata service is being rotated tonight at 02:00. The old key will remain valid for a 24-hour grace window, after which requests will return 401. Please update the on-call vault entry and restart the renderer pods. The new key is below.

app token of bahaf-tajeg = zpat23_SjjsllwiLmXbtS65veZaV47